Turkey - Number of Seats in Railway Vehicles
Since 2014, Turkey Number of Seats in Railway Vehicles jumped by 5.8% year on year. With 220 Thousand Seats in 2019, the country was number 4 among other countries in Number of Seats in Railway Vehicles. Turkey is overtaken by Austria, which was number 3 with 238 Thousand Seats and is followed by Sweden with 197 Thousand Seats. Poland topped the ranking with 397 Thousand Seats in 2019, that is a fall of 2.9% versus 2018. Turkey witnessed the best average annual growth at +5.8% per year, while Romania recorded the worst performance at -14.4% per year.
